Meaning of snoop

The primary meaning of the word "snoop" is to secretly watch or investigate someone or something, often in a sneaky or stealthy manner.

Etymology of snoop

The word "snoop" originated in the mid-19th century, likely from the Dutch word "snoepen," which means to eat or drink furtively, or to prowl or sneak around
The word initially meant to prowl or sneak around, often with the intention of stealing or spying, but its meaning has since expanded to include the act of secretly watching or investigating someone or something
